Katie and Leo actually met one another through mutual friends two weeks ago. It only took them a few days until they started talking with one another and they actually went on their first date last week. Katie tells us that they got coffee and actually walked through a cemetery while talking. Katie thought things were going in the right direction so she bought tickets for the two of them for a Nationals game, but randomly Leo stopped talking to her and she isn’t sure why. 
  
We call Leo trying to figure out if there is anything else between him and Katie that happened that may have caused things to go wrong and he tells us that he bumped into someone who changed things for him. Find out what’s really going on in this Second Date Update!
